Step dancing in Cape Breton and Scotland: contrasting contexts and creative processes
peer-reviewed Abstract: This article briefly outlines the migration of percussive step dancing to Cape Breton Island from the Scottish Highlands in the 19th century and the introduction of this dance genre to Scotland from Cape Breton in the 1990s.
